Spotlessly clean, comfy room with some nice touches (for an excellent-value B&B): toiletries including proper handwash; tissues; mints; biscuits; bottled water; replenished (without fail) tea & coffee etc etc... Some of the sockets in our room even had USB ports. There's a fridge on the landing on both floors and you can help yourself to fresh milk if you prefer it to the usual UHT in the rooms (little jugs provided). We used the fridge, though, to chill a bottle of wine! Owners Gill and Andrew are lovely and their 18 years experience as B&B hosts shines through. It's a great base for wandering in the area. Stayed for 3 nights and didn't need to get into the car once - it just sat there gathering blossom the whole time! Short 8 minute stroll into Conwy town centre and beyond. Did a lovely, easy coastal walk to Llandudno (about four and a half miles) and hopped on the number 5 bus back to Conwy (thanks for the info on the buses, Gill). Andrew cooked us one of the best breakfasts we've ever had anywhere. Superb quality ingredients - and plenty of them - prepared to order and to perfection. The sausages are to die for! Didn't mind at all being asked to come for a certain time to breakfast as this ensures your food arrives as soon as it leaves the pan.
